WebException report refers to a statement disclosing the dissimilarity between actual and expected occurrences. A negative deviation is alarming to the management, and subsequent corrective action is necessary, whereas a positive variation is perceived as good and requires no improvement. It is widely used by auditors, accounting professionals ...
